The potential summit between Donald Trump and Vladimir Putin in Hungary is causing significant unease among EU leaders, particularly due to Putin's status as a wanted figure by the International Criminal Court for war crimes. This situation raises serious concerns about the implications of hosting a leader with such allegations on EU soil. Additionally, Ukraine's President Volodymyr Zelensky has expressed his willingness to attend if invited, which could further complicate the diplomatic landscape. This matter is crucial as it touches on international law, security, and the delicate balance of power in Europe.
